What are the characteristics of oil-free air compressors?
Oil-free air compressors are mostly used for precision instrument air supply, which determines the particularity of the industry it is used in. In the field of machinery, with the improvement of the precision of pneumatic parts, the requirements for oil and water in compressed gas are getting higher and higher. In the past, new products of oil-free air compressors were widely used due to quality problems. With the improvement of the quality of oil-free air compressors, the quality has undergone fundamental progress, which can completely meet the needs of modern industrial production. The superiority of the oil-free air compressor in the use process is reflected.
1. Because the lubricating oil is very viscous, the current degreasing equipment cannot completely remove it, so the oil-free characteristic of the gas compressed by the oil-free air compressor is irreplaceable.
2. The current refrigerated dryers, heatless regenerative dryers, micro-heat regenerative dryers and other water removal equipment lose the function of water removal due to the oil in the compressed air; and the clean oil-free air compressed by the oil-free compressor , fully protects the water removal equipment, and reduces the additional capital occupation caused by the maintenance of the water removal equipment.
3. The use of oil-free air compressors to provide compressed gas to the outside world will not greatly reduce the load on the motor due to the pressure loss caused by the oil removal equipment, and achieve energy saving effects.
4. The oil-injected air compressor wastes a lot of lubricating oil. Taking a 7.5KW high-quality oil-injected air compressor as an example, the low consumption of 5 kg of lubricating oil per month will cost an extra 60 kg of lubricating oil in one year. In addition, in order to remove the oil in the compressed gas, a high-efficiency oil filter must be used, and the filter element needs to be replaced many times, which is also a large expense.

HIGH-PRESSURE COMPRESSED AIR FOR BRAKING POWER
Automobile Market in India
Tumblr media
India is the 4th largest producer of automobiles in the world, with an average annual production of more than 4 million motor vehicles. As per the reports, the Indian passenger car market is expected to reach USD 160 billion by 2027 while registering a CAGR of over 8.1% between 2022-27. India could be a leader in shared mobility by 2030. As a result, many manufacturers are investing in new manufacturing plants and increasing capacities in existing plants to cater to the increasing demand.
Overview
Brakes are one of the most critical parts of the active safety systems in automobiles. Better the brakes, the safer the vehicle. Based on the power source, brakes are classified as follows.
Mechanical braking system
Hydraulic braking system
Air or pneumatic braking system
Vacuum braking system
Magnetic braking system
Electric braking system
Out of the above, hydraulic brakes, especially disc brakes, are used predominantly in modern-day automobiles because of higher reliability, increased braking force, etc. Most cars manufactured today use the disc brake system; some manufacturers still use drums; however, their effectiveness diminishes in comparison to the disc brake.
Disc Brake Systems are most widely used in almost all modern-day vehicles, so the need for a good quality disc brake at optimum cost is extremely high. This, in turn, creates a market for more research to be done to optimize the product by keeping the safety intact, thereby creating a huge potential in the field of testing.
Disc Brake Operation
Tumblr media
The disc braking system involves many different components, but at its most basic function, the system consists of a disc/rotor, a brake caliper, and brake pads. When the brake pedal is applied, brake fluid creates pressure, squeezing the brake pad against the rotor and creating friction. This friction slows the rotation of the wheels and the vehicle itself.
Brake calipers are a clamp-like component that fits over the disc. Their primary function is to push the brake pads into the disc, and they do this via pistons and hydraulic brake fluid. Inside the calipers are pistons, which have brake pads attached to them. When we put our foot on the brake, pressurized fluid is sent to the pistons, and they push against the pads, which come into contact with the disc surface.
Testing of Brake Calipers
No product reaches the user before it gets tested. Different products undergo different testing processes. Even though various braking system components are tested separately, the calipers should be tested after assembly for leakage and fault-free operation.
Though the hydraulic brake uses brake fluid for the operation, pneumatic testing with high-pressure air will be used in the testing process of the brake assemblies. Using high-pressure air relatively decreases the testing time and increases the life of components compared to hydraulic testing. It also prevents hydraulic oil spillage, thus maintaining a clean and safe work Environment.
Once the brake caliper components are assembled, high-pressure air will be filled and held inside the component. The Pressure range would be approximately 250 barg. In case of any leakages, there would be a drop in air pressure, and thus the leakages in the component will be identified.
The products passing the test parameters will be approved, and the components get rejected if there are any leakages.
Testing of Brake Hoses
Tumblr media
Since the actual operation of these brakes is with hydraulic oil, the oil needs to be also fed at pressure to the callipers during operation. This is achieved by a hose connecting the fluid sump to the callipers.
Since the brake operation is at high pressure, the hose carrying also has to be rated at high pressure; thereby, they are also subject to high-pressure pneumatic testing to maintain overall safety.

What Makes Screw Air Compressors the Preferred Choice for Air Experts?
Tumblr media
When seeking the optimal air compressor solution for your operations, it's essential to consider various parameters which extend far beyond the upfront cost. The productivity and effectiveness of your material handling systems, spray painting procedures, and diverse machine tools are heavily contingent upon the compressed air system. Consequently, industry experts often advocate for the adoption of screw air compressors for their exceptional efficiency, continuous operational capacity, reduced noise levels, space-saving design, and reliability.
Air compressors can be broadly categorized into two types: reciprocating and rotary screw compressors. Reciprocating compressors use pistons to compress air, while rotary screw compressors utilize rotating elements to generate compressed air. Among them, rotary screw compressors consist of interlocking helical rotors that compress the air as it moves through the compression chamber, allowing for continuous and efficient operation.
Screw Air Compressors
Screw air compressors are known for their efficiency, reliability, and ease of use. They typically use oil for cooling, sealing, and lubrication within the compressor. These compressors consist of two rotors, often referred to as male and female rotors, which have interlocking helical grooves that reduce the volume of air as it passes through the compression chamber. As the rotors rotate, air is drawn into the chamber, trapped between the lobes of the rotors, and compressed as the volume decreases. The injected oil provides cooling and lubrication, ensuring smooth operation and minimizing wear on the components. The compressed air and oil mixture are then separated, with the oil being cooled and recycled, while the compressed air is discharged.
Types of Rotary Screw Air Compressors
There are two main categories of rotary screw air compressors commonly used in businesses and manufacturing:
Oil-free Screw Air Compressors: These compressors operate without the need for oil lubrication. Instead, alternative lubricants such as PTFE, distilled water, or proprietary coatings are used for lubrication and heat dissipation. Oil-free compressors are essential for industries where even the tiniest trace of oil is unacceptable, such as food and beverage production, pharmaceuticals, packaging, and other sensitive sectors.
Oil-lubricated Screw Air Compressors: In oil-lubricated screw compressors, oil is introduced into the compression chamber to facilitate lubrication and efficient heat dissipation. The oil undergoes a separation process from the discharge stream, followed by cooling, filtration, and recycling. These compressors are commonly used in heavy drilling and mining operations, metallurgical processes, mobile tire services, and various other applications that can tolerate minimal traces of oil.
Advantages of Screw Air Compressors
Screw air compressors offer several advantages, making them highly recommended by air experts:
High Efficiency: Compared to reciprocating compressors, screw compressors are known for their high energy efficiency. The continuous compression process reduces energy waste.
Continuous Operation: Screw compressors provide a steady and uninterrupted supply of compressed air. They don't require frequent start-stop cycles, which can affect efficiency and equipment lifespan.
Low Noise and Vibration: Screw compressors produce less noise and vibration due to their helical rotor design. This makes them suitable for noise-sensitive environments.
Maintenance and Reliability: With fewer moving parts compared to reciprocating compressors, screw compressors are known for their reliability and require minimal maintenance. This results in reduced downtime and maintenance costs.
Applications of Screw Air Compressors
Screw air compressors find applications in various industries and sectors, including:
Industrial Manufacturing: Screw compressors are widely used in automotive assembly lines, metal fabrication, plastics production, and more. They power pneumatic tools, robotic systems, and machinery.
Construction and Building Sites: They are commonly used to power jackhammers, nail guns, sandblasting equipment, and painting systems on construction sites.
Automotive Industry: Screw compressors play a vital role in automotive manufacturing and repairs. They power air tools, assist in tire inflation, and enable pneumatic systems in car assembly lines.
Food and Beverage Production: Screw compressors provide clean and compressed air for various operations in the food and beverage processing industry. They control packaging systems, power pneumatic conveyors, and ensure product quality.
Pharmaceuticals and Healthcare: In pharmaceutical manufacturing, screw compressors supply clean compressed air for aseptic processes, packaging, and equipment operation. In healthcare, they power medical air systems for respiratory therapy and surgical equipment.
Pneumatic Tools and Machinery: Screw compressors are extensively used to power a wide range of pneumatic tools and machinery, ensuring efficient operation.
